If your checked bag exceeds the standard weight limit on United Airlines in 2026, you will be charged an overweight baggage fee in addition to the standard checked bag fee. For Economy passengers, the weight limit is 50 lbs (23 kg). If your bag weighs between 51 and 70 lbs, the fee is typically $100 to $200 per bag, depending on your destination. If the bag is between 71 and 100 lbs, the fee can jump to $400 or more for international routes. Note that United generally refuses to carry any bag over 100 lbs (45 kg) for safety reasons. For those in United Business, United First, or with Premier Gold status and higher, the weight limit is increased to 70 lbs (32 kg) at no extra charge. A high-value "pro-tip" for 2026 is to weigh your bag at home; if you are over 50 lbs, it is often significantly cheaper to pack a second "overflow" bag and pay a second bag fee (around $45–$100) than to pay the heavy overweight penalty for a single large suitcase.
